Output 5ae1069f50f8bd3d22deacfe473116ddb7ebfdec2ae2ef590f148d68b4d17c58:0

value
76760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2af44260f4efabb73f65098e244f9fda2b15bc47 OP_EQUAL
address
35c8v2uqasNgzDCajbkmaaTGtpHivVMxVk
transaction
5ae1069f50f8bd3d22deacfe473116ddb7ebfdec2ae2ef590f148d68b4d17c58
confirmations
44691
spent
true